Wyoming Range Public Input Process

Welcome to the Wyoming Game and Fish Department Wyoming Range Mule Deer Webpage

Thank you for your interest in the Wyoming Range mule deer herd. This is a world-class herd, and we're glad you have decided to join in the dialogue about it. On this page you will find a draft of the Wyoming Range mule deer management plan. The plan's executive summary features the new actions the Wyoming Game and Fish Department will be implementing in this herd unit.

This plan is the culmination of a series of public meetings held in western Wyoming in June and August of 2010, and February of 2011. This public involvement process and resulting management plan is being developed under direction of the state's Mule Deer Initiative, which is a statewide framework designed to address declining mule deer populations. During these meetings we received feedback on what people in attendance viewed as the biggest issues related to mule deer in the Wyoming Range, and what solutions could be used to address those issues. This feedback formed the basis for the draft plan. If you would like more information on the public input process, explore this page for presentations and notes from the meetings.

A Note from the Director

February 3, 2011

   

Dear Wyoming Range Participant:

 

Thank you for your continued interest in assisting the Wyoming Game and Fish Department develop a plan for mule deer management in the Wyoming Range.  Game and Fish personnel have been working hard to complete a draft plan after two successful sets of public meetings, held in June and August.  We are looking forward to sharing our draft with you at the February 7-10, 2011 meetings in Marbleton, Afton, Kemmerer, and Green River.  The input we received so far has been very helpful and we sincerely appreciate the time you spent with us.

 

On this website, you will find a comprehensive list of ideas generated from our previous public meetings.  This information will help us focus priorities for deer management in the Wyoming Range for the next 5 to 10 years.  Information from the June meetings was prioritized into the categories of habitat management, population management, law enforcement, research, public involvement and outreach, and predator management.  In August, we used the June information to develop possible solutions, forming the basis of the draft plan.

 

In our third set of public meetings, we will present this draft management plan and you will be able to give feedback at that time.  It will also be available on this web page so those who were not at the meetings may comment.  Written comments will also be accepted through March 15, 2011.  The plan will be finalized with the public input and presented to the Wyoming Game and Fish Commission at a future meeting.

 

We look forward to the final round of meetings and implementing the plan to benefit mule deer.  Again, your help in ensuring the future of this magnificent wildlife resource is appreciated.
